Pfc. Nathan Cook, a Cavalry Scout assigned to 1st Squadron, 1st Cavalry Regiment, 2nd Brigade Combat Team, 1st Armored Division, observes a training area while acting as the opposing force defending a village during exercise Strike Focus, at Orogrande Range Camp, N.M., April 5, 2019.
Strike Focus is a multi-week exercise training the 2nd BCT's capability to be a lethal fighting force and their ability to rapidly deploy at a moment's notice.
